Read moreGreat, casual, local deli restaurant. I came across Luda’s on a hunt for good perogies, and was not disappointed. I really wanted cottage cheese perogies, but they serve potato filled. Even so, these were some of the best restaurant perogies I’ve had. Perfectly fried (they also offer boiled and deep fried), nicely topped with fried onions, and served with a generous dollop of sour cream, just the way they should be. I ordered them with kielbasa (“Kubasa” on their menu) - a good choice.
This is not a fancy place, but that’s part of its charm. The dining room is small, and the service very familiar and friendly. If you want water, coffee, or tea, help yourself.
Take note: cash only, and the deep frying is done in peanut oil.
